发明名称 METHOD AND SYSTEM FOR REAL TIME INTERACTIVE DYNAMIC ALIGNMENT OF PROSTHETICS
摘要 An objective method and system for dynamic analysis of prosthesis-bound subjects for determining optimal prosthesis alignment adjustments consists of a motion detection system, motion database, blending engine and algorithms, and a graphical user interface with suitable program controls whereby manual, semi-automatic, or fully automated analysis of a prosthesis-equipped subject's motion performance can be done in real time to determine objectively the optimal adjustments for the subject's prosthesis in a precise clinical protocol context.
